On her return to India Miss Dutt studied Sanscrit with her father for a year, and made two translations from the "Vishnu Purana," which were published in Anglo-Indian magazines. She next began to translate a French lady's, work" La Femme dans l'Inde Antique," but ht'r health failed, and on August 30th, 1877, she died, as her sister had done, of consumption.
